Poetry, and perhaps something more, has always beaten at the heart of all of Flavia Company’s books. Here the full force of its pulse is felt. The why, the ‘secret’, of her immersion in the poem is revealed to us by the author herself in the form of a prologue. A journey, a monologue, memory and the present. Flavia Company does away with all borders, dissolves the lines between genres and explodes labels to make what should always be made: literature. A daring verse about a continuous line, an emotion communicated in punctuation marks. Those who have left, those on their way, those who are leaving, and as the famous tango song says so well: Volver, going back. A boomerang thrown into history. Life with no holds barred.
